Deye DEYE SPRING RW SERIES
This datasheet provides complete technical specifications for the DEYE SPRING RW SERIES RW-F10.2. Key specifications include a LiFePO₄ battery type, 10.2 kWh rated energy, 6000+ cycle life, and IP65 protection. Designed for residential energy storage solutions in the United Arab Emirates.
Technical Specifications
| Parameter | RW-F10.2 |
|---|---|
| Battery Module | |
| Battery Type | LiFePO₄ |
| Built-In Circuit Breaker | 125A 4P, 60Vdc |
| Capacity (Ah) | 200 |
| Nominal Voltage (V) | 51.2 |
| Operating Voltage (V) | 43.2 - 57.6 |
| Rated Energy (kWh) | 10.2 |
| Usable Energy (kWh) | 10.2 |
| Scalability | Max. 32 pcs pack (Max. 326kWh) in parallel |
| Rated DC Power (kW) | 6 |
| Max DC Power (kW) | 12 |
| Charge / Discharge Current (A) | Charge: 100 / Discharge: 100 |
| Peak Current (A) | Charge: 198 / Discharge: 240 |
| Operating Temperature (°C) | Charge: 1 - 55 / Discharge: -20 - 55 |
| Storage Temperature (°C) | 0 - 35 |
| Weight Approximate (kg) | 104 |
| Dimension (W × H × D, mm) | 600 × 760 × 200 |
| Master LED Indicator | SOC state (20% - 100%), work state (alarming, protecting) |
| Humidity | 5% - 95% |
| Altitude | ≤3000m |
| Cycle Life | ≥6000 (25°C±2°C, 0.5C / 0.5C, 70%EOL) |
| IP Rating of Enclosure | IP65 |
| Installation Location | Wall-Mounted, Floor-Mounted |
| Recommend Depth of Discharge | 100% |
| Communication Port | CAN2.0, RS485 |
| Energy Throughput | 32MWh (25°C, 0.5C / 0.5C, 70%EOL) |

What is the cycle life of the DEYE SPRING RW-F10.2?
The DEYE SPRING RW-F10.2 has a cycle life of ≥6000 cycles at 25°C±2°C with a charge/discharge rate of 0.5C and 70% end of life (EOL). This ensures long-term reliability for residential energy storage.
What battery chemistry does the DEYE SPRING RW-F10.2 use?
The DEYE SPRING RW-F10.2 uses LiFePO₄ (Lithium Iron Phosphate) chemistry, known for its safety and stability in residential energy storage applications.
How many batteries can be connected in parallel in the DEYE SPRING RW-F10.2?
The DEYE SPRING RW-F10.2 supports scalability up to 32 units in parallel, allowing for a maximum energy storage capacity of 326kWh.
